Sally by Freya North

Meet Sally. (Well-mannered English rose of twenty-five.) A primary school teacher from Highgate, Sally's decided to re-invent herself as a femme fatale and all-around sex-goddess. Goodbye Laura Ashley; au revoir M&S undies; hello Erica Jong. Meet Richard. (Six foot two and a bit, perfectly carved and gorgeously chiselled.) Thirty-five-year-old architect from Notting Hill, confirmed bachelor and the unknowing target of Sally's masterplan. She's determined to be the one great erotic heroine of his life. He's going to be her dream affair - no strings, no scone-baking. Just sex and sensuality. Until, that is, a New Year masked ball unmasks more than was intended...Until Richard, unwittingly, threatens all that Sally holds dear. From London Zoo to the Pompidou, from tiramisu to I love you, join Sally and Richard on their roller-coaster ride of self-discovery, self-denial, seduction and spots (proving Sally can't change hers) in this fabulous, fresh and funny first novel.
Freya North holds a Masters Degree in History of Art from the Courtauld institute. She has worked for the National Art Collections Fund as well as for a commercial sculpture garden and freelanced as a picture researcher before starting to write full-time. She lives in London.
